Troy Allen Presley, 54, passed away peacefully on Sunday, August 10, 2025, in Louisville, Kentucky. Born on April 11, 1971, to Mona Ray Caple, Troy was a lifelong resident of Louisville and a beloved son, nephew, cousin, and friend.

Though born with cerebral palsy and non-verbal, Troy possessed an extraordinary spirit and a powerful presence. His strength of will and remarkable ability to communicate through his facial expressions and actions touched the hearts of everyone around him. Troy had a rare gift for teaching others the true meaning of unconditional love, resilience, and living life without limitations.

Troy had an infectious joy and a wonderful sense of humor. His smile could light up any room, and his laughter was a source of happiness for all who knew him. He was a bright, shining light whose enthusiasm was contagious.

He found joy in the simple pleasures of life—watching his favorite shows like Gunsmoke, wrestling, and cartoons, visiting with neighbors during long walks, caring for his cherished pets, Moose and Lucy, and especially going to the fair to enjoy cotton candy. These moments brought him peace and happiness, and they will be remembered with love.

Troy was a great human being, full of inspiration, kindness, and warmth. His legacy is one of joy, strength, and boundless love. He will be deeply missed by his family, friends, neighbors, and all who were fortunate enough to share in his life.

May he rest in peace, wrapped in the love he gave so freely.

Troy is preceded in death by his father, Bob Caple; and an uncle, Doug Mills.

Left to cherish his memory, Troy is survived by his mother, Mona Caple; aunts, Donna Sue Curtsinger and Norma “Buke” Caudell; cousins, Wendy Kennett, Eddie Mills, Glenda Meredith, Christy Daugherty, Sherry Herman (Mark), Aaron Daugherty, and Brooklyn Linton; and a host of close friends.

A memorial service for Mr. Troy Presley will be held at 1 PM on Saturday, September 6, 2025, at Louisville Memorial Gardens West Funeral Home. Visitation will be held from 10 AM to 1 PM at the funeral home, prior to the service. Burial at Louisville Memorial Gardens West will follow the memorial service.
